## Metrics sidecar (Cinderpipe) — flush behavior

Context for the sync: the sidecar aggregates counters in-process and flushes to the collector on an interval. Problem: under burst load the flush queue grows unbounded and the sidecar OOMs before the main container notices. Proposal: bounded queue, drop-oldest policy, adaptive flush when queue passes a high-water mark. Tested on the Quarryvale canary for a week; p99 memory flat, metric loss under 0.1% at 3x normal load. No protocol changes. Tuning constants we landed on are below.

tuning table, yajog-yahof:
BUDGETS = {
    "lamvan": 303,
    "wenox": 460,
    "fenvan": 525,
}

**Release checklist — Tax-rate lookup cache (Ledgerly)**

Before you ship: flush the tax-rate cache and confirm the warm-up job repopulates all regions within five minutes. Skipping this once gave a merchant stale rates for a whole afternoon, so don't. Note the artifact you verified against right under this item.

session token of kageg-tahop = htk14_af3c1ccccb7dcf

Subject: Cut-over done — cold starts mostly tamed

Hi support crew — the Wrenfold handler migration wrapped last night. Short version: cold starts on the quote-lookup endpoint dropped from ~6s to under 900ms after we moved to provisioned warm pools and trimmed the dependency bundle. You may still see the odd slow first request right after a deploy; that's expected for about ten minutes. If customers report lag beyond that window, escalate to platform. For reference when triaging tickets, the handlers now run with the settings below.

settings of fafog-haduf:
ZORIX_PIN=4648
ZORIX_METRICS_HOST=metrics.zorix.paliqsys.corp
ZORIX_LOG_LEVEL=info
ZORIX_TENANT=druix

Subject: Granbury Franchise Agreement — Update

Executive team, please ensure branch managers are briefed: the franchise agreement with Orvath Holdings for the Granbury territory was executed on Friday. Key terms include a seven-year initial period, standard royalty structure, and shared marketing obligations from Q2. Operational onboarding begins next month under Freya Dolmans. Full strategic context appears in the confidential note below.

internal memo for kaguf-yajog: Headcount on the Druath team goes from 30 to 70 by the end of November. Gross margin on Druath came in at 56 percent against a plan of 28 percent.